Subject: Cut-over complete — Larkspan LB health checks

Cut-over done at 02:10. All traffic now routes through the new Larkspan balancer pool. Health checks switched to the readiness probe; old liveness path is dead. Two nodes ejected during transition, both recovered. No customer impact observed. If anything flaps overnight, roll back via the standard playbook. Current active health-check configuration is shown below.

settings of tahof-yagug:
ralix:
  log_level: warn
  metrics_host: metrics.ralix.lumicsys.internal
  pin: 5546
  pool_size: 16

Following the Q3 review, Harlowe Dynamics will reduce the marketing budget by 18% for the coming fiscal year. The cut primarily affects the Brightline campaign and sponsorships in the Calverton region. Digital channels managed by the Meridial team retain current funding, given stronger conversion metrics. Headcount is unaffected; agency retainers with Forsythe Creative will be renegotiated. Leadership believes the reduction can be absorbed without material impact on pipeline targets. The rationale connects to a confidential plan noted below.

board note of hafop-yagug: Headcount on the Wenix team goes from 13 to 77 by the end of July. Gross margin on Wenix came in at 6 percent against a plan of 18 percent.

TICKET #—: Missed pick-up, seed samples

Site: Dunmarle trial plot, receiving shed B.

Scheduled collection of twelve sealed seed-sample pouches from Greyfen Agronomics did not occur yesterday. Pouches remain in the chilled locker; viability window closes Friday. Re-booked courier for tomorrow, first run. Receiving site to have paperwork ready at the gate. Apply the following hand-over instruction on arrival.

dispatch memo: the lamwyn fenwyn courier leaves the wenir ledger at gate 7175 under passcode 822969